Equivalent & Substitute Parts Reference: TEL 15-4813

Part Overview

TEL 15-4813 (Traco Power) is an isolated module DC-DC converter with a single 15V 1A output and a wide 36V–75V input range, suitable for ITE (Commercial) applications. Its product status is "Not For New Designs," necessitating the identification of alternative models with matching electrical and mechanical parameters. Engineering substitution is required to maintain functional compatibility and compliance with existing designs where sourcing the original part becomes impractical.

Substitute Part Grouping Explanation

Substitute parts are selected strictly by matching the following key criteria:

  • Isolated module DC-DC converter type.
  • One output with identical voltage and current ratings (15V, 1A).
  • Power rating of 15W.
  • Voltage isolation of 1.5 kV.
  • Matching input voltage range, mounting type, package/case, size/dimension.
  • Compliance with ITE (Commercial) application standards.
  • RoHS3 compliance.
  • Mechanical compatibility (through-hole, DIP package) and identical size.

Substitution is permitted only where these primary electrical and mechanical parameters converge.

Frequently Asked Questions (FAQ)

Q1: What electrical parameters must match for DC-DC converter substitution?
A1: Voltage and current ratings, input voltage range, power, voltage isolation, and number of outputs must be equivalent.

Q2: Are mechanical package and mounting type critical when selecting substitutes?
A2: Yes, substitutes must have the same package/case dimensions and mounting type for direct PCB replacement.

Q3: Is RoHS compliance mandatory for substitutions in regulated environments?
A3: Substituted parts must match the RoHS compliance level of the original part when required by application standards.

Q4: What is the impact of product status when selecting a replacement?
A4: "Not For New Designs" status requires selection of an active part to ensure future availability.

Q5: Do substitute parts listed offer identical input ranges for all applications?
A5: Substitute parts must have an input range that covers or matches the original part's input specification.
